Tyre pressure control manual mode
General notes
In manual mode, you can freely set the tyre
pressure. When setting, always observe tyre
size, axle load and speed. If you exceed the
permissible speeds in manual mode, no warn-
ing tone sounds. Also, the tyre pressure con-
trol system does not automatically increase
the tyre pressure.
